Construction is changing, and we are at the forefront of that change. We are looking for a Build (Site) Manager to join us in the Yorkshire region. Our aim is for you to be a part of our team to deliver projects close to home across multiple sectors mainly in leisure, education, blue light, residential and healthcare. As a Site Manager at Willmott Dixon, you will be part of our one team ethos that delivers quality projects on time whilst also having a positive impact on the local community.

As a Site Manager at Willmott Dixon the key responsibilities will include:


Key responsibilities include:

  • Reporting to the Construction Manager, the successful Site Manager will manage the delivery of projects safely, on time, within budget and to the highest quality.
  • Establish standards of quality on-site and ensure delivery of a quality build in accordance with the project specifications and project requirements.
  • Adopt the principles of the Considerate Constructor’s Scheme and manage community relations. Ensure appropriate site image is maintained to encourage repeat business.
  • Undertake the works in the most economic manner to eliminate waste and avoid non-recoverable costs and preliminary losses. Monitor and work to the agreed preliminary budget.
  • Produce and develop project programmes and control operations to achieve delivery of the project on time. Organise the works and supply chain to provide the right working environment to avoid disruption between trades.
  • Understand the client priorities and adopt a professional and considerate approach to maintain good working relations.
  • Maintain the highest standards of health, safety and environmental management.
  • Manage project handover and ensure defect/snag free completion.
  • Support the strategy for the closure of defects during defects period and obtain a certificate of Making Good Defects within targets set.
  • Proven track record of successfully delivering construction projects as part of a wider team
  • The ability to read and accurately interpret programmes, drawings and technical specifications
  • Understanding and appropriately sharing build programmes
  • Managing the supply chain, direct employees and consultants
  • Proactively liaising with customers and the supply chain
  • Appropriate CSCS card
  • SMSTS certificate
  • First Aid at Work certificate.
